What does a travelogue contain? A travelogue contains vivid descriptions of the place you’re traveling in , descriptions of the subjective experiences of visiting a place (your thoughts, blunders, fears), informed commentary about a place (its history and culture), and accounts of your interactions with local people.

What is the format to write a travelogue?

A travelogue is an essay-type piece of writing , so all rules for essays work here too. There are three elements: introduction, main body, and conclusion. There are also some peculiarities that we should mention in our guide.

What is a travelogue in English?

1 : a piece of writing about travel . 2 : a talk or lecture on travel usually accompanied by a film or slides. 3 : a narrated motion picture about travel.

What are the types of travelogue?

What are the types of travelogue? A travelogue can exist in the form of a book, a blog, a diary or journal, an article or essay , a podcast, a lecture, a narrated slide show, or in virtually every written or spoken form of creation.

What is the purpose of travelogue?

Generally, a travelogue provides a place to preserve memories , provide a purpose for travel, and offer a connection with local communities. The main purposes of a travelogue though are to inform readers about a place, landscape or culture.

What is the blend word of travelogue?

Answer: Supposedly a blend of travel +‎ monologue , coined by Elias Burton Holmes. laminiaduo7 and 8 more users found this answer helpful.

Is travelogue and brochure the same?

travelogue : alternative spelling of travelog which is a travel lecture,film or slides. travel brochure: a brochure ,often from a travel agency which advertise holidays ,hotels etc.
